Peter Berlin, who became a name in 70s San Francisco for wearing low rise jeans with a VPL, is still alive & well
He is in his 70s now and seems quite humble for someone who broke down barriers back in the 70s. He walked around the streets of S.F. in skin tight low-rise jeans, with a very visible VPL (before that was a thing like it is now). He was never in the closet and always openly gay, which meant all doors were closed to him, so he had to build his own career.
Very interesting man, from a poor aristocratic family in Germany, to photographer to pornographer.
